About Bachelor in Game Development

Tuition fees for Bachelor in Game Development are 29,060 MYR per year.

The Bachelor in Game Development at University of Wollongong Malaysia is for students who love gaming and want to create their own games. This 3-year degree teaches you how to design and build games.

The program covers subjects like game design, programming, and visual effects. You will learn how to use software like Unity and Unreal Engine to create games. You will also work on projects to build your own games and learn from feedback.

After graduating, you can work as a Game Designer, Software Engineer, Game Artist, or QA Tester. You can work for game development studios, tech companies, or start your own game development business. Your skills will be useful in creating engaging and interactive games.

About University of Wollongong Malaysia

University of Wollongong Malaysia in Shah Alam brings an Australian university experience to Malaysia since its establishment as a regional campus of University of Wollongong. Founded in 1983 and serving around 5,000 students, the campus offers a focused range of five program clusters designed for international and local students seeking globally recognized qualifications. Its location in Shah Alam combines convenient urban access with a supportive campus environment.

Academic offerings emphasize industry relevance, research-informed teaching and opportunities for cross-border exchange with the wider University of Wollongong network. Small class sizes encourage close faculty interaction, and student services include academic advising, career support and English language assistance. The campus fosters practical learning through internships, industry projects and employability workshops aimed at preparing graduates for competitive job markets.

Student life in Shah Alam includes cultural diversity, affordable living costs and active clubs that reflect international student interests. Bachelor in Game Development: Frequently Asked Questions

What are the fees for Bachelor in Game Development?
Tuition: MYR 29,060 per year. Service fee: USD 100.
What are the entry requirements for Bachelor in Game Development?
Entry requirements include: Education: High School; Academic performance: Grade C-B (55%-60%, GPA 2-2.5); English: IELTS 5.5-6.0; Age: 18-30.
Is Bachelor in Game Development available online?
This is an on-campus program at University of Wollongong Malaysia in Shah Alam.
